Oddball Posted May 19, 2009 Report Share Posted May 19, 2009 Hi All I have a 2in single bore exhaust system on my 6 with one box. The system came originally from Racetorations including a 6,2,1 manifold. Three years ago I replaced the silencer with a phoenix unit I acquired at Malvern and this did quieten things down a bit. However the exhaust if still a bit loud and it generates a course high-pitched sound unlike the much-loved richer deeper growl that we all love. Having spoken with phoenix they do produce a quieter version of the box I have (PXTH 606Q) but cannot tell me how much quieter it if. Does anyone have one have any knowledge of this silencer and its performance? The other possible answer is to go to Longlife exhausts and add in another small silencer further up the system. My car runs on triple Weber’s which also adds to the noise so a quieter exhaust can only help Thanks Cameron Quote Link to post Share on other sites

harrytr5 Posted May 20, 2009 Report Share Posted May 20, 2009 After driving a few thousand miles with a straight throu exhaust silencer and getting resonance boom I decided to try the quieter silencer from Phoenix which was designed for the German TUV market.Fitted it and although it did quieten things down a bit it was not as much as I would have liked.Well after putting on more than a few thousand miles including Europe it is so much quieter and I am now very happy.It is a joy to cruise at 70+ in overdrive top now. Regards Harry TR5 Nutter. Quote Link to post Share on other sites
